Syracuse woman accused of bringing dangerous substance into Rome prison that hospitalized officer

ROME, N.Y. (WSYR-TV) — A woman from Syracuse is accused of bringing a suspicious substance into the Mohawk Correctional Facility that hospitalized five prison staff members.

New York State Police arrested 53-year-old Shondrea Taylor of Syracuse and charged her with two counts of promoting prison contraband.

Taylor is accused of posing as a visitor to the prison and bringing an envelope holding pieces of paper soaked with an unknown substance…
